Management

Question 6

 

Contribution margin is:

 

sales less cost of goods sold

 

sales less variable production, variable selling, and variable administrative expenses

 

sales less operating expenses

 

sales less all variable and fixed expenses

 

Question 8

 

Managerial accounting:

 

is primarily concerned with providing information to external users

 

must always follow generally accepted accounting principles

 

provides information to help managers make decisions in the future

 

emphasizes objectivity and verifiability

 

 

Question 9

1 pts

During October, Clyde Barrow Corporation incurred $62,000 of direct labor costs and $4,000 of indirect labor costs. The journal entry to record the accrual of these wages would include a:

 

debit to Work in Process of $62,000

 

debit to Work in Process of $66,000

 

debit to Work in Process of $4,000

 

credit to Work in Process of $66,000

 

Question 10

1 pts

During December, $74,000 of raw materials were requisitioned from the storeroom for use in production. These raw materials included both direct and indirect materials. The indirect materials totaled $6,000. The journal entry to record the requisition from the storeroom would include a:

 

debit to Raw Materials of $74,000

 

debit to Manufacturing Overhead of $6,000

 

debit to Manufacturing Overhead of $74,000

 

debit to Work in Process of $74,000

Answer Preview

Ans. 6

Contribution margin is: sales less variable production, variable selling, and variable administrative expenses.

 

 

Ans. 8

Managerial Accounting uses financial accounting as its base to provide special purpose information and reports to the managers to operative effectively.

So, The correct option is "provides information to help managers make decisions in the future".

 

Ans. 9

Direct labor expense incurred is chargeable to work in progress. Indirect labor expense incurred is charged to overheads. Direct labor incurred is chargeable to cost of goods manufactured.

Hence, correct option is "debit to Work in Progress of $62,000".

 

Ans. 10
